Legal classification

What training do I need and when?

The three e-learning modules in the hygiene package serve different purposes. Therefore, the underlying requirements also differ.

BEFORE STARTING WORK

Initial instruction according to § 43 IfSG
For individuals commencing activities under Section 42 of the Infection Protection Act (IfSG) for the first time. Initial instruction is provided by the public health department or a duly authorized body. Not included in this package.

WITH APPROPRIATE ACTIVITY

§ 4 LMHV (German Food Hygiene Regulation) Professional Knowledge
Persons who produce, process or distribute highly perishable foodstuffs require the necessary expertise, unless this can already be demonstrated through appropriate professional or scientific training. Not included in this package.

REGULAR / ANNUAL

Food hygiene training
According to Regulation (EC) No 852/2004, persons handling food must be supervised according to their activities and must receive instruction and/or training in food hygiene. This knowledge should be refreshed regularly and as required by the company. In practice, we recommend an annual refresher course.

EVERY TWO YEARS

Follow-up instruction pursuant to Section 43 of the Infection Protection Act (IfSG)
Every 24 months.

Food allergen training Companies must ensure that employees handling allergenic ingredients or allergen information can reliably perform their duties. The scope and frequency of training depend on the specific role and the company's training needs. We recommend refresher training at least every two years.

No. Before commencing any activity under Section 42 of the Infection Protection Act (IfSG), initial instruction under Section 43 of the IfSG is required. This instruction is provided by the public health department or a duly authorized body and is not part of the hygiene package.

No. The training according to § 4 LMHV is a separate specialist training course. Whether it is required depends on the activity and the professional or scientific background of the person.

The requirements for refresher training differ: Follow-up instruction according to Section 43 of the Infection Protection Act (IfSG) must be completed after starting work and then every two years. For food hygiene training and allergen training, refresher courses depend on the specific job, the risks involved, and the company's training needs.
